Kuwait: The head of the surgery department at Jaber Ahmad Hospital, Dr Sulaiman Al-Mezeey, confirmed that the hospital’s huge surgical capacity is back to the capacity of 3 surgical rooms, the largest number currently in Kuwait, citing that at least 50 surgeries have been performed in the period of 12 months.

He further thanked the efforts taken by the health minister Dr Khaled Al-Saeed, the health agent Dr Mustafa Reda and the Ministry’s view on developing Jaber Hospital and making it a specialized integrated hospital.

He added that the operating rooms at Jaber Ahmed Hospital are unique and each room is designed to suit a specific surgical specialty with the possibility of containing other specialties when needed, all of them are the first of its kind operating room in the world that operates using the phone system.

The complete unique Easy Suite 4K from Its type, implemented by OLYMPUS, a world leader in the field of surgical and digital microscopic technology, has the latest technology in design, implementation and processing in the world.

He added: Through this room, you can contact and transfer information to anywhere in the world and the possibility of transmitting the events of surgeries directly in the international medical conferences and aid.

 According to other medical opinions from anywhere in the world, as surgeons can control most of the equipment inside this room with one touch, as well as the latest 3D/4K optometry technology, this step is a pioneering move. It will result in the transfer of a specific strategy in the field of medical services development in Do Kuwait, which has global standards and the latest medical trial.
